NameLongtooth Grouper
Scientific NameEpinephelus bruneus
Common NamesLongtooth Grouper, Brown-marbled Grouper
FamilySerranidae
OriginWestern Pacific, East Asia
Temperamentaggressive
Dietcarnivore
Care Levelexpert
Minimum Tank Size (Gallons)1000
Max Size (Inches)47
Water TypeSaltwater
Temperature Range (°F)72-79
pH Range8.1-8.4
Compatible SpeciesNone suitable for typical home aquariums

Description

The Longtooth Grouper is a large, predatory marine fish known for its robust body and mottled brown coloration. It is a solitary species found in rocky reefs and coastal waters of the Western Pacific. Due to its significant adult size and predatory nature, it is not suitable for typical home aquariums.
